For three days, 40,000 rock and metal fans gather in the countryside of western France (Clisson, just outside of Nantes) for this annual festival. Headlined by Def Leppard, Kiss, and Volbeat, this year's event saw Nexo's new STM system make its Hellfest debut on the two main stages.

French rental company Melpomen has provided the audio kit for Hellfest since its inception in 2006, and, as Melpo has been a big Nexo user for nearly 20 years, the festival has always been Nexo-centric. With STM onboard this year, that meant more headroom and more control than ever before, according to Thierry Tranchant, Melpo's president.

South Africa - MJ Event Gear supplied the full technical for the Black Management Forum Corporate Update Dinner, held recently at the Sandton Convention Centre.

A thousand guests, including South African government and business leaders, were invited to the black-tie occasion.

With the client only confirming the technical four days prior to show day, the greatest challenge was to build the set. Project manager and head of crew, Zeeks Sebatjane of MJ Event Gear, and lighting designer, Johnny Scholtz, had already come up with the design. The team at Driftwood, under the guidance of Jaco Meyer, put the set together in record time. The stage incorporated white flats and two big screens.

South Africa - Born in Sydney Australia Kevin Maybury was attracted to the world of theatre at a very early age. By the time he was 16 he was already working backstage and making scenery for the amateur dramatic productions being staged at the YMCA theatre in Sydney. From there, he moved on to the Tivoli Theatre in Sydney

As soon as he left school he was on his way to Melbourne; headquarters of Australia's professional theatre production company, JC Williamson.

One of the theatrical companies that toured Australia in those days was the Royal Shakespeare Company from Stratford-on-Avon, which afforded Kevin an invaluable Introduction when he arrived in England seeking employment. Kevin joined the company as it was about to embark on a new venture, which was a season of three plays to be staged the Adelphi Theatre in London. Japan - For the second year in succession, RCF was chosen to support Japan's Big Beach Festival (BBF) at the Makuhari Seaside Park in Chiba, which this year saw Norman Cook (Fatboy Slim) - who performed at the Festival back in 2011- and Basement Jaxx as headliners.

Promoted by Akira Kidoguchi and Masachika Fukui for A-life Entertainment Co. Ltd., rental company Comestock again equipped the three stages with RCF TT+ Touring & Theatre systems to satisfy an audience totalling around 25,000 people.

In addition to the usual armoury of high-powered TT+ line arrays there was a surprise for anyone visiting the party tent known as the 'Disco Balloon'. Six of the new TTP5-A enclosures (three per side) were making their Japanese debut in the Balloon - supplied (as with all the RCF equipment) by the Italian manufacturer's territorial distributors, Ballad Co. South Africa - To commemorate the 1976 Soweto uprising, 16 June, also known as Youth Day, is a public holiday in South Africa. Events aimed at young South Africans are held across the country and this year a draw card was a concert by Zakes Bantwini held at the Durban ICC on Friday, 14 June.

Zakes Bantwini returned to his home province for the Upfront with Zakes Bantwini live concert. The show was brought to fans by the Ethekwini Municipality and Mayonie Productions. Black Coffee was commissioned to provide the full technical for the event.

Australia - As of 1 June, 2013, authorised Shure distributor for Australia, Jands Pty Ltd, began distributing conferencing products manufactured by Danish Interpretation Systems (DIS), a division of Informationsteknik Scandinavia Group of Copenhagen, Denmark, which Shure acquired in February 2011.

"With the acquisition of Informationsteknik, Shure has reinforced our position in the installed sound market. Together, Shure and DIS have a history of innovation, quality and customer commitment, and with our strong and dedicated network of distributors, we will deliver state-of-the-art conferencing solutions to an expanded customer base," said William Chan, managing director of Shure Asia Limited.

UK - Dating from the 13th century, the Chester Mystery Plays production involves hundreds of amateur actors, volumes of volunteer work and a great audience from different corners of the UK and from all over the world. Organized every five years, this year's performances took place for the first time ever in the Chester Cathedral's nave, where about 100 CHauvet Professional fixtures lit the set.

"In order to bring these 700-year-old Mystery Plays to life, I knew I had to deliver some spectacular effects," said lighting designer Chris Ellis. " I also knew we needed a large lighting rig to do justice to the large setting in the Nave of Chester's medieval cathedral. Germany - The first live show in Europe to use Robe's new Pointe moving light fixtures was headlined by DJ and house music producer David Guetta at the DR2 Plaza Festival in Hannover.

The Pointes, supplied by satis&fy AG, were part of the specification provided for his headline slot enjoyed by 17,000 fans who packed the venue.

Guetta's lighting designer is Leggy (Jonathan Armstrong), and lighting is looked after on the road by lighting director Junior (Alex Cerio) from Smash Productions.

Armstrong is a big Robe fan and has used various Robe products in his work for some time. He was delighted to get the chance to run 20 x Robin Pointes - making their worldwide concert debut - in Hannover.

Peru - Together with Novolite screen & Light s.a.c, MA Lighting's distributor in Peru, MA Lighting Latin America, has just finished its grandMA 3D competition in Lima. Twenty young LDs selected from 50 participants had the chance to present their designs in the auditorium of the UNIFEM in Lima during the contest.

The contest was an ideal opportunity to showcase the use of grandMA 3D as a free pre-programming and design tool. It also showed that in combination with the free grandMA2 onPC software, users could access a real life design studio.

USA - Constructed inside the shell of a vacated Boeing Defence Systems plant, Eastside Christian Church in Anaheim, Calif. is centred on a 1,765-seat worship auditorium. A Meyer Sound Constellation acoustic system and a MIca line array loudspeaker system were installed here to provide flexible sonic enhancement for Eastside's contemporary worship band and musical events.

In addition to supplying variable acoustics, Constellation also helps lend a sense of small-room intimacy to the teaching segments of senior pastor Gene Appel and others. "The main benefit of Constellation is that we can finesse it. We are not locked into a permanent acoustical decision as we would have been with a fixed acoustical ceiling," says Chris Gille, Eastside's CTO and chief systems engineer.

UK - Greenford-based rigging specialist Actus Industries has invested in new Kinesys Elevation 1+ controllers, Liftket chain hoists and a LibraCELL load monitoring system to expand its rental stock.

Actus Industries is headed by Andy Martin, and its senior management team includes some of the most experienced and respected practitioners in the production, show and event industry.

The business has three separate divisions; equipment hire, selected sales and project management.

Actus general manager Adam Beaumont explained that they always intended to go into automation and the choice of brand was made because, "Kinesys is easily the best option'.

They recently won the contract to supply the full rigging package to Robbie Williams' Take The Crown tour, and at this point decided to expand their Kinesys elements.
